Conventional Editorial Review

**** "A Technical History of America's Nuclear Weapons: Volume II - Developments from 1960 Through 2020 - Second Edition" is an impressive and exhaustive work that serves as a vital resource for anyone interested in the evolution of nuclear armaments in the United States. The depth of information contained within these volumes is remarkable, providing readers with not just the technical specifications of various weapons systems but also the historical context during which these developments took place. The reviewer highlights that Volume I lays a solid foundation by examining the early development of nuclear technology post-World War II, notably through the continued efforts at Los Alamos and the importation of German expertise. This volume provides a comprehensive view of the United States' strategic needs in response to the Soviet threat during the Cold War era, showcasing the intricate interplay between military branches in the development of tactical and strategic missile systems. As the series progresses, the inclusion of detailed information on components, missile variations, and the historical narrative enriches the reader's understanding. However, while the in-depth analysis is a significant strength, it can occasionally dampen readability with excessively intricate details, particularly in the latter chapters of Volume II. Some readers may find themselves skimming through sections that delve too deeply into minutiae, yet the wealth of data presented—such as specifications of various warheads, diagrams, and a thorough acronym list—remains invaluable. Notably, the work is described as an essential reference for military historians and enthusiasts alike, earning a reputation as a "bible" on the subject. While the reviewer noted a few minor errors, these do not overshadow the overall quality and importance of the content, making it a critical addition to any serious military or historical library. **
